Why go?
If you're looking for sun, sea and sand with an added dash of fun, you can't beat a holiday in Playa de las Americas. On Tenerife's sunny southwest coast, this popular resort is home to the dark volcanic sands of Playas de Troya and Playa de Bobo. You'll find a picturesque beachfront promenade, plenty of home comforts and loads to do, from a wealth of water sports to great days out including Mount Teide National Park and Santa Cruz, the island's capital. When it comes to shopping, you can bargain-hunt in duty-free outlets, the twice-weekly Torviscas Market and little shops selling local handicrafts. It's easy to get there too - Playa de las Americas is just 11 miles from Reina Sofia Airport.
Things to do
Holidays in Playa de las Americas are packed with activities. In the water, there's jet skiing, windsurfing, scuba diving and sailing. On dry land you can take a bouncy camel ride, enjoy a round or two on the 18-hole golf course and take the mini train to Playa de las Americas' neighbouring resorts. Families and friends will love Aqua Park, with its water slides and dolphin shows. Spend balmy evenings in Playa de las Americas' tasty assortment of restaurants. You'll find everything from traditional Spanish dishes like tapas and paella to international cuisine like Indian, Chinese and Italian. Throw yourself into the party atmosphere, with countless bars, pubs, discos, clubs and even a casino.
